Case Study:

Year-End Review Experience

Problem

In December 2022, The Washington Post launched Newsprint, our inaugural year-end review experience (OK, fine — our version of Spotify Wrapped!). The proof of concept was successful and foundational, but left opportunities to push the 2023 version beyond basic data points and a neutral tone.

Goals

Increase retention and engagement metrics for the 2023 version by delivering a delightful, novel experience to users that highlights the value of their subscription using reading history data.

Process

Newsprint is an almost year-long project involving product, design, marketing, data and analytics, newsroom, and other stakeholders. I led content design, partnering with a product designer on the overall experience — from entry points to the end screen.

First, I created a new tone guide for Newsprint. I aimed for a more casual, fun vibe in line with our target audiences — while also making sure it would be appropriate accompanying often-grim news.

We relied on multiple rounds of user testing and interviews to validate ideas and copy, figuring out what kinds of information were valuable to users (and what they thought was lame). Recommending multiple authors? A slog. Seeing their top author thank them personally on video? A hit.

I also created our now-signature “reader types,” which tell you about your news-reading habits, working closely with our data and analytics team.

This process is truly massive, with complex content mapping, a ton of fallback states, and an intense QA process. I also took on some project management responsibilities, setting deadlines and milestones.

Outcome

Newsprint has become a subscriber-favorite. It’s helped the reader–journalist connection, while also increasing reader engagement with newsletters, alerts, and authors:

  • Article save rate increased 112%

  • Newsletter sign-up rate increased 25%

  • Flow completion rate increased 6%

  • Median time spent increased 72%

  • Unique signed-in visitors to Newsprint increased 56%

  • Total visits to Newsprint increased 94%
